Highest Education Level

Safety Specialists in Texas off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
32.9%
High School or GED
18.0%
Vocational Degree or Certification
16.9%
Master's Degree
14.3%
Associate's Degree
13.7%
Some College
1.9%
Doctorate Degree
1.6%
Some High School
0.7%
